Summary:This article overviews some of the research progress on the effects of incorporating liquid crystalline functionalities into commercial conjugated polymers such as polythiophene, polypyrrole and polyaniline. Polarisable aromatic mesogens are generally attached via a flexible spacer group to the monomers to form a side-chain. Consequently, the self-organising properties of liquid crystals can be used to influence the conducting polymer backbone and control the electrical, magnetic and mechanical properties of the material. Some applications of these interesting materials are discussed.
